Output 3103d5e6a3d6b951a233695b4fe749dfc8d3aa85c254e6be8559d2b5a98ccea6:0

value
1033065629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707d28113566eb0a63c77683057c9c6647a0d0f5 OP_EQUAL
address
3BwoY4BegvzuKWxDLPTMpHaK31ySC7q6L4
transaction
3103d5e6a3d6b951a233695b4fe749dfc8d3aa85c254e6be8559d2b5a98ccea6
spent
true